Dino Cookie Bites

These delicious cookie bites are packed full of protein and make the perfect lunch box or after school snack.
Dino Cookie Bites

Preparation time: 10 minutes
Makes 16

Ingredients
  • ¼ cup - 50g natural, sugar-free and salt-free peanut butter
  • 1 tablespoon rice malt syrup
  • ½ cup - 240ml coconut cream
  • ¼ cup - 60ml coconut oil, melted
  • ½ teaspoon sea salt flakes
  • ½ cup  - 60g coconut flour
  • ⅓ cup - 40g chilled cooked quinoa. (Quinoa is tiny, bead-shaped, with a slightly bitter flavour and firm texture)  

How to make Dino Cookie Bites
  1. In a large bowl mix together the peanut butter, rice malt syrup, coconut cream and coconut oil. 
  2. Add the sea salt flakes, coconut flour and quinoa and mix to form dough. Add a little more coconut flour if the mixture is too runny to form into balls. 
  3. Pinch off little pieces of the dough and roll into walnut-sized balls. Store in an airtight container and consume within three days.
